Our client is seeking a Product Manager to join their team! This position is located in SeaTac, Washington.
Duties:
- Develop user stories granular enough to be achieved in a single sprint elaborate on Epics and Features create and maintain the product backlog support user and application testing and coordinate release activities
- Implement new technologies and products while transitioning through changing processes
- Provide day to day support of the product portfolio including managing support inquiries responding to user feedback and creating communications
- Partner with the User Experience teams to provide guidance and prioritization during the product development process and participate in user research and product discovery activities
- Assist the product engineering and scrum teams through feature review grooming sprint planning and demos by being the voice of the customer and communicating the value behind each product and prioritization decision
- Coordinate new and changed functionality with affected business groups to ensure seamless rollout of new capabilities
- Analyze data including transactional data usage statistics primary guest agent research and industry analyst reports to inform prioritization and solutions
- Collaborate with external vendors in the design delivery and support of hardware and software products
- Collaborate with internal groups in the design delivery and support of product features
- Coordinate and host monthly stakeholder meetings to report on product delivery team progress and updates on committed roadmap items
- Bachelors degree or an additional 2+ years of relevant training experience in lieu of this degree
- 2+ years of experience in product management or related area
- Solid understanding of Image Reservations and Sabre systems
- Demonstrated ability to create and implement flow charts
- Demonstrated ability to facilitate user group meetings with stakeholders
- Demonstrated ability to manage multiple projects at the same time
- Demonstrated ability to work well with others as part of a team
- Effective verbal and written communication skills
- Detailed oriented and highly organized with ability to multi task and work independently with limited guidance in a fast paced environment
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ications such as: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Outlook
